## v3.1.4 — Pooler Key Rotation

We rotated the credentials used by the Fernwick connection pooler after expanding pool sizes from 20 to 50 per node. Old sessions drain gracefully over ten minutes; no customer impact expected. Verification of pooler release artifacts should use the updated signing key shown here.

signing key of bagap-yawep = bky13_TbfT6ZMUoGJo2

# Greenhouse controller env — Vinebarrow unit 3. Heads up for the sync:
# the humidity probes are drifting again, so DRIFT_CORRECTION_INTERVAL
# is down to 15m and SENSOR_SMOOTHING is on. Recalibration job runs at
# dawn. The calibration uploader still needs its access token, set on
# the next line.

vault entry, yajop-bafop: ARCHIVE_KEY3=8d4

Changelog — PoolPal 4.1 (support team edition)

Heads up, folks: we renamed a setting. PP_DB_KEY is now POOLPAL_DB_CREDENTIAL, because customers kept confusing it with the cache key. If a customer reports "missing credential" errors after upgrading, that's almost certainly this rename. Old configs still boot but log a warning until 4.3. When walking a customer through the fix, have them open their env file, delete the old entry, and add the renamed setting on the next line.

vault entry, kadup-bafog: COURIER_KEY5=6648d

## Further reading

Idempotency keys are mandatory on every retryable call to the Pextral payments gateway. Reuse the same key across retries of one logical charge; never mint a new one mid-retry. Keys expire after 48 hours, after which a replay becomes a duplicate charge. The Tollgrim team's write-up covers edge cases, key derivation, and failure modes. Start here before touching retry code.

runbook for badug-kadup: https://confluence.zemvarlabs.internal/projects/browse/display/projects/bd1b